    CVE-2025-6424 – Firefox FontFaceSet Use-After-Free Crash Vulnerability

    June 24, 2025

    CVE ID : CVE-2025-6424

    Published : June 24, 2025, 1:15 p.m. | 1 hour, 23 minutes ago

    Description : A use-after-free in FontFaceSet resulted in a potentially exploitable crash. This vulnerability affects Firefox
    Severity: 0.0 | NA
